Twelve months ago I put an EHEYCIGA XL orthopedic dog bed on the floor of our bedroom and watched my eight-year-old German Shepherd, Atlas, circle it twice and then drop onto it like he had been waiting years for exactly this. Atlas weighs 95 pounds, has mild hip dysplasia confirmed by X-ray in late 2024, and had been sleeping on a $30 poly-fill cushion that flattened inside three months. I have a background in healthcare and I look at dog bedding through a particular lens: support geometry, foam density, moisture resistance, and how long materials maintain their rated properties under real daily load. This review covers everything I tracked over the past year.
The short version: the EHEYCIGA held up better than I expected for the price. It is not perfect. The foam has lost a measurable amount of loft by month twelve. The cover's zipper pull cracked around month eight and had to be worked carefully. But the waterproof liner survived two full accidents without wicking through, the foam still provides meaningful pressure relief for Atlas's hips, and I have not once seen him choose the hard floor over the bed. For a large-breed senior dog with documented joint issues, that is the metric I care about most.

Atlas sleeps on this bed every night and uses it for post-walk naps three to four times a week. That translates to roughly 1,400 to 1,500 hours of contact time over the year. He is a sprawler, not a curler, so the XL size (40 by 35 inches) was the right call. His entry style is a controlled drop from a standing position rather than a gentle lowering, which stresses foam differently than a dog that eases down gradually. I mention this because foam testing in a lab and foam tested by a senior large-breed dog who drops his full weight onto the same spot each night are very different experiments.
I measured foam height at three points across the main sleeping surface at months 1, 3, 6, 9, and 12, using a ruler through the unzipped cover. The foam started at a consistent 4 inches across the board. By month twelve, the center of the preferred sleeping spot measured 3.5 inches. That is a 12.5 percent compression in Atlas's primary impact zone. The perimeter foam, which bears far less load, remained essentially at starting height. That compression curve is actually better than several higher-priced competitors I tested in the same period. It also matches the trajectory a human would expect from a medium-density viscoelastic foam under sustained body weight.
For reference, a $30 poly-fill bed that flattened in 90 days compresses faster by a factor of four or five. The EHEYCIGA is not a premium therapeutic mattress, but it is meaningfully better than poly-fill alternatives, and that gap widens over time.
The Memory Foam: What the Specifications Actually Mean
EHEYCIGA does not publish an official foam ILD rating (Indentation Load Deflection, the standard measure of foam firmness) in their listing. Based on how the foam behaves under load, I estimate it sits in the 25 to 35 ILD range, which is on the softer side for large dogs. This matters because a dog with hip dysplasia needs a bed that relieves pressure at the greater trochanter and hip joint while still providing enough resistance that the pelvis does not sag into an unsupported position. Too soft and you get pressure relief without structural support, which can actually worsen alignment. Too firm and you get the opposite problem.
In practical terms, when Atlas lies on his side, his shoulder and hip sink in enough to relieve point pressure, but his spine remains level rather than bowing. That is the correct outcome. I noticed in months one through four that he would lie down more readily at night and spend less time repositioning before settling. By month six his morning stiffness, measured informally by how long it took him to walk normally after rising, had improved compared to the poly-fill bed baseline. I cannot attribute that entirely to the bed since he was also on a glucosamine supplement by that point, but the sleep surface change happened first.
By month six, Atlas was settling in about 90 seconds. On the old poly-fill bed he would reposition six or seven times before lying still. The difference in settling time was the first thing I noticed.
Waterproof Liner: The Test That Actually Matters
The EHEYCIGA uses a TPU-coated inner liner that wraps the foam separately from the outer cover. This two-layer approach is the right design choice. Many competing beds use a water-resistant outer cover as the only moisture barrier, which means that if the cover zipper is open even slightly, or if liquid saturates the cover fabric, the foam beneath gets wet. Wet foam is nearly impossible to dry fully, leads to mold growth, and loses structural integrity faster than dry foam.
Atlas had two significant accidents over the year. One at month three during a stomach illness, one at month nine after a late-evening water binge before bed. Both times I removed the outer cover, wiped down the TPU liner with diluted white vinegar, and dried it with a towel. The foam beneath was dry both times. The outer cover went through the washing machine on cold, hung to dry, and came out without any detectable odor or staining. No mold. No softening of the foam layer. I consider this the best performance outcome possible from the waterproofing design.
One note on the outer cover zipper: the pull tab cracked at the base around month eight. The zipper itself still functions, but I have to use a pen cap to work it now. This is a minor material failure that EHEYCIGA could address with a metal pull tab instead of a plastic one. It did not affect usability, but it is worth knowing if you handle the zipper frequently, as I do for washing.
Washability Over 12 Months
I washed the outer cover twelve times over the year, roughly monthly. Machine wash cold, hang to dry as the instructions specify. The fabric held color well through the first eight washes. By month ten I noticed slight pilling on the top sleeping surface in the area of heaviest contact. This is normal for a microplush fabric under sustained friction and body heat, and it did not affect function, just appearance. The cover never shrank enough to cause a difficult refit over the foam.
The bolster design around the perimeter, which Atlas uses as a chin rest, stayed reasonably firm throughout. I had expected this section to compress faster since he loads it with his head and neck weight during naps. It lost maybe a quarter inch of height over the year, which is negligible. The low-profile entry at the front of the bed, a design feature intended for dogs with joint issues who cannot step over a high bolster, remained clear and functional throughout. Atlas uses that entry point every time.
Performance for a Dog with Hip Dysplasia: What I Actually Observed
I want to be careful here, because anecdotal improvement in a single dog is not a clinical study. What I can say with confidence: Atlas's observable sleep quality improved, his morning stiffness decreased, and he seeks this bed out voluntarily every night. He had a follow-up orthopedic exam at month ten and the veterinarian noted his muscle mass around the hip had maintained better than expected for his age and diagnosis, which the vet attributed partly to quality rest. I did not prompt that comment.
The bed's contribution to this is almost certainly the combination of consistent surface support and moisture-free sleeping conditions. A dog who is waking up damp, cold, or lying on an uneven surface gets less restorative sleep, and reduced sleep quality in dogs with joint disease compounds the condition over time. A good sleep surface is not a substitute for veterinary care or appropriate supplementation, but it is a legitimate part of a joint health management plan. I now recommend orthopedic bedding in that context without hesitation.

Who This Is For
This bed is the right choice for owners of large and giant-breed dogs, particularly seniors or dogs with confirmed joint conditions like hip dysplasia, elbow dysplasia, or spondylosis. If your dog weighs between 60 and 120 pounds, has documented joint issues, and you want a waterproof orthopedic surface that will hold up for a year or more, this delivers on that promise at a price point that makes it accessible without feeling compromised. It is also a solid choice for dogs who are incontinent or prone to accidents, because the two-layer moisture protection is genuinely functional rather than marketing language.

Who Should Skip It
If your dog is a chewer, the outer cover's microplush fabric will not survive. This is not a criticism of EHEYCIGA specifically; no fabric-covered bed is chew-proof. Dogs who shred bedding need a chew-resistant bed with a canvas or ballistic nylon cover, which is a different product category entirely. Also, if you are looking for a bed for a small or medium dog under 40 pounds, the EHEYCIGA foam density may be more than you need, and you will be paying for support engineering that never gets used. Finally, if you need the foam to last more than two years under a very heavy dog (over 110 pounds), I would suggest budgeting up to a denser orthopedic foam option.
